A recent study by Amrita Kundu, PhD, Moogdho Mahzab, and Erica Plambeck, with field research support from ARCED Foundation, examines how an import barrier on batteries in Bangladesh affected public health and the environment.

The study finds that the import barrier contributed to the expansion of domestic battery recycling, increasing exposure to lead pollution. The health consequences were serious: the rate of miscarriages increased by 4 percentage points, and the share of pregnant women unable to deliver a live baby rose from 16 out of 100 before the import barrier to 20 out of 100 after it was in place.

These findings show why trade and industrial policies must be designed together with strong environmental regulation and public health safeguards. Policies intended to protect domestic industries can create serious risks if pollution-intensive activities expand without adequate monitoring and enforcement.
